European style kitchen cabinets, also known as frameless cabinets, differ from traditional American-style cabinets in that they don’t have a face frame. This frameless design results in a more modern, streamlined appearance and maximizes storage space by utilizing the entire width of the cabinet. The doors attach directly to the sides of the cabinet box, offering a seamless and minimalist look that’s popular in modern and contemporary kitchens across Europe.
The design is often characterized by clean lines, flat surfaces, and a minimalist approach that emphasizes functionality and elegance. Since there are no frames, the hinges are hidden, adding to the cabinet’s smooth appearance. The overall aesthetic is simple yet sophisticated, making European-style cabinets an excellent choice for homeowners who prefer a clutter-free and spacious look.

One of the primary benefits of European-style kitchen cabinets is the maximization of space. Without a face frame, you can utilize every inch of the cabinet for storage, making them ideal for smaller kitchens or those who need extra storage space. Additionally, their modern design blends well with various interior styles, from minimalist to industrial.
Another significant benefit is the flexibility in design and customization. Because European cabinets focus on simplicity, they allow you to choose different finishes, colors, and hardware, giving you endless possibilities for personalization. Their durability and easy maintenance make them practical for busy households.

Finishing is key to achieving the signature European sleekness. You can either paint the cabinets for a high-gloss finish or use a wood veneer for a natural look. If you’re going for a painted finish, use high-quality paint that’s durable and easy to clean.
Alternatively, a laminate or veneer can provide a durable surface that mimics the look of wood without maintenance. Be sure to sand the surface between coats of paint or finish to achieve a flawless, smooth finish.
Maintaining European-style kitchen cabinets is relatively easy due to their simple, flat surfaces. Regular cleaning with a mild detergent and soft cloth will keep them looking new. Avoid abrasive cleaners that can scratch the finish, mainly if you’ve used a high-gloss paint or veneer.
Additionally, check the hinges and drawer slides periodically to ensure they remain tight and functional. Proper maintenance will ensure your cabinets stay in top condition for many years.
